Royal Oak cooling centers open during heat watch: June 30 alert details
Royal Oak’s June 30 “Beat the heat!” notice (posted at 9:12 a.m.) lists cooling centers and hours for a Tue–Thu watch with heat index expected to exceed 105°F.

Starting July 1, Royal Oak’s water/sewer bill uses $16.95 per unit (100 cu ft) plus a “readiness to serve” fee based on your meter size.
